Understanding How Wiring Issues Cause Random Electrical Shutdowns in Vehicles
Wiring issues are among the leading causes of electrical failures in vehicles, often resulting in random shutdowns. A vehicle’s electrical system relies on a complex network of wires, connectors, and fuses to deliver power to critical components such as the ignition system, fuel pump, and electronic control units (ECUs). Over time, these wires can become corroded, frayed, or damaged due to wear and tear or exposure to moisture.
For example, in older vehicles like the Ford F-150 (1997-2003), the wiring harnesses can suffer from insulation degradation, leading to short circuits. When the electrical flow is interrupted, the vehicle may shut down unexpectedly. Similarly, in models like the Honda Accord (2003-2007), bad ground connections can cause sporadic electrical issues, including stalling. Checking the integrity of these connections is essential to ensure reliable operation.
Another common issue is poor connections at critical junctions, such as the battery terminals or fuse box. Loose connections can result in voltage drops, preventing essential systems from receiving the power they need. If you hear a clicking sound when turning the key, this might indicate a poor connection rather than a dead battery. Tightening connections or replacing corroded terminals can often resolve these issues.
Identifying Key Symptoms of Electrical Failures Before They Lead to Shutdowns
Identifying symptoms of electrical failures early can save you time and money. Pay attention to warning signs like flickering dashboard lights, slow engine cranking, or intermittent power loss to accessories like headlights and radio. These symptoms indicate potential wiring or electrical component issues.
Another telltale sign is the behavior of the engine itself. If your engine sputters or hesitates before stalling, it might be due to a failing fuel pump relay or a malfunctioning crankshaft position sensor. For example, the crankshaft position sensor in a Chevrolet Silverado (2007-2013) can fail, causing the engine to shut off abruptly. Using an OBD-II scanner can provide error codes that help identify specific issues, such as P0335 for crankshaft sensor problems.
Additionally, listen for unusual noises. A clicking sound when turning the ignition key can suggest a starter issue or a weak battery. If the engine turns over slowly, it may indicate a failing battery or a bad alternator. Regularly checking your battery’s voltage and the alternator’s output can help catch these issues before they lead to a shutdown.
DIY vs. Professional Repairs: Costs of Fixing Electrical Problems in Cars
When it comes to fixing electrical problems, knowing when to tackle a repair yourself and when to seek professional help is crucial. Simple repairs, such as replacing a blown fuse or a faulty relay, can often be done at home with basic tools and knowledge. Costs for these parts typically range from $20 to $80, making DIY repairs economically appealing.
However, more complex issues, such as diagnosing wiring harness problems or replacing critical components like the fuel pump, require professional expertise. Labor costs for diagnostics can range from $80 to $150, while repairs involving significant labor, such as replacing a fuel pump, can cost between $250 and $600, depending on the vehicle make and model.
For those unsure about their skills, hiring a professional can prevent further damage and save money in the long run. Complex repairs, like fixing a malfunctioning ECU or addressing wiring harness issues, can range from $600 to $1,500, depending on the extent of the problem. Always weigh the potential risks and costs associated with DIY repairs against the benefits of professional assistance.
Essential Maintenance Tips to Prevent Electrical Shutdowns in Your Vehicle
Preventing electrical shutdowns starts with regular maintenance. Here are some essential tips to keep your vehicle’s electrical system in top shape:
- Regularly inspect battery terminals and connections for corrosion. Clean the terminals as needed and ensure they are securely fastened.
- Check the condition of your vehicle’s wiring harnesses, especially in older models. Look for frayed wires or signs of wear, and replace them if necessary.
- Ensure that all fuses are functioning properly. Replace any blown fuses with the correct amperage rating to avoid electrical issues.
- Keep the alternator and charging system in check. Regular testing can identify weak components before they fail.
- Replace worn or faulty sensors promptly. Sensors like the mass airflow sensor or throttle position sensor are critical for engine performance and can lead to shutdowns if malfunctioning.
By implementing these maintenance practices, you can reduce the likelihood of encountering electrical problems that lead to shutdowns. Regular checks and timely replacements will extend the lifespan of your vehicle’s electrical system and improve overall reliability.
Frequently Asked Questions
How much does it cost to fix a faulty wiring harness?
The cost to fix a faulty wiring harness can vary significantly depending on the extent of the damage. Simple repairs may cost around $100 to $250, while complete harness replacements can range from $600 to $1,500 or more, depending on the make and model of the vehicle.
Can I drive with a failing alternator?
Driving with a failing alternator is not advisable. While it may still power your vehicle temporarily, a failing alternator can lead to a dead battery and unexpected shutdowns, leaving you stranded. It’s best to address alternator issues promptly to avoid further complications.
Is replacing a blown fuse a DIY fix?
Yes, replacing a blown fuse is a straightforward DIY fix. Locate the fuse box, identify the blown fuse, and replace it with one of the same amperage. This task typically requires minimal tools and can be done in just a few minutes.
What are the signs of a bad battery?
Signs of a bad battery include slow engine cranking, dim headlights, and electrical accessories not functioning properly. If you notice these symptoms, it’s a good idea to have the battery tested and replaced if necessary.
How often should I check my vehicle’s electrical system?
It’s advisable to check your vehicle’s electrical system at least every six months, especially before long trips. Regular checks can help identify issues early, preventing unexpected shutdowns and ensuring reliable vehicle operation.
